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our team arrives at your warehouse and assesses the damage to find out the extent of the water damage. We contain the affected area to prevent further damage and prevent the growth of mold and mildew.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our team uses specialized equipment to extract the water from the affected area. We use a combination of pumps and wet vacuums to remove as much water as possible.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our team uses specialized equipment to dry out the affected area and remove any remaining moisture. We use dehumidifiers to prevent the growth of mold and mildew.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Our team cleans and sanitizes the affected area to prevent the growth of mold and mildew. We use specialized cleaning solutions to remove any dirt, grime, and bacteria.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Our team works with you to restore your warehouse to its original condition. We replace any damaged materials and reconstruct any areas that were affected by the water damage.

Warehouse Water Damage Restoration Cost in Artondale, WA

The cost of Warehouse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Artondale, WA. Here are some estimated costs for common scenarios: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of cleaning required
Restoration and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and type of materials required
Dehumidification and drying equipment rental $100 – $500 Duration of rental and type of equipment required
Moisture detection and assessment $100 – $500 Size of affected area and complexity of assessment
Containment and isolation $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and type of containment required

Q: How long does the restoration process take?

The restoration process can take anywhere from a few days to several weeks,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
